Output e7892123f68a94ce8808d6d421cb6ed71325db3634f7e1bd8b94a9273daed8c1:20

value
1071891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ac2a84417ccaf51e6f5b1466af700a183aabae OP_EQUAL
address
3CEdsuvQKfyFcRazcDswt9EvaZ6hAJqvBS
transaction
e7892123f68a94ce8808d6d421cb6ed71325db3634f7e1bd8b94a9273daed8c1
spent
true